Rishabh Pant, yet to fully recover from his injuries, recently embarked on a spiritual journey to Kedarnath Temple in Uttarakhand. The cricketer was spotted on his way to the temple where he was accompanied by Uttarakhand politician Umesh Kumar.

Upon landing near the holy place, Pant was greeted by a number of over-enthusiastic fans eagerly awaiting the arrival of the dashing wicketkeeper-batsman.

Indian cricketer Rishabh Pant attended the divine Kedarnath Temple in Uttarakhand as part of his spiritual journey amidst physical recovery. The wicketkeeper-batsman landed near the temple space and was accompanied by Uttarakhand politician Umesh Kumar along with a number of security personnel.

Rishabh Pant was involved in a near-fatal car crash on December 30 last year. The accident left him with injuries on his head, back and feet which subsequently forced him to skip all cricketing action to date.

Pant skipped the entire IPL 2023 season for Delhi Capitals as well as India’s Asia Cup 2023 campaign in Sri Lanka. Moreover, the injury also forced him out of contention for India’s World Cup 2023 squad.

The dashing wicketkeeper-batsman spent much of his time at the National Cricket Academy (NCA) in Bengaluru earlier this year, where he worked towards attaining full recovery alongside injured Indian stars Jasprit Bumrah, Shreyas Iyer and KL Rahul at one stage.

Having played the last of his 129 internationals for India in December last year, it remains to be seen when he will grace the cricket field once again for his country.
